  • What is a bread subscription?
    A bread subscription is a recurring order that reserves your bread in advance. Your loaf is baked fresh (each week, every other week, or monthly) and set aside for pickup or delivery, so you never have to reorder or worry about sell-outs.

    How often do subscriptions renew?
    Subscriptions renew automatically on a recurring schedule (weekly, bi-weekly, or monthly, depending on the option you select).

    Is there a minimum commitment?
    No long-term contract is required. You can manage, pause, or cancel your subscription according to the policies below.

    Why are subscriptions priced lower than one-time-purchase loaves?
    Subscriptions allow us to plan bakes more efficiently, which helps us offer better pricing for committed members.

  • What do I receive with my subscription?
    Each subscription includes:

    • One half or whole loaf per delivery (based on your plan)

    • Freshly baked bread made after payment

    • Rotating seasonal flavors or your selected favorite

    • A free bonus loaf during 5-week months

    Can I get two half loaves instead of one whole loaf?
    Yes. You may choose two half loaves instead of one whole loaf, and they may be different flavors.

    Do subscribers get priority?
    Yes. Subscription members receive priority baking and guaranteed availability each week.

  • When will I be charged for my subscription?
    Subscription billing occurs automatically before baking begins.

    Weekly: Billed every week on the same weekday as your start date
    Bi-Weekly: Billed every other week on the same weekday as your start date
    Monthly: Billed on a fixed calendar day each month (ex: the 1st)

    What happens if my payment fails?
    If a payment doesn’t go through, Squarespace will attempt to retry. If payment cannot be processed, your subscription may pause until updated.

    Will I be charged during skipped weeks?
    No. If you pause or skip a week before the cutoff, you will not be charged for that cycle.

    Will I be billed during baker breaks or planned pauses?
    No. Planned baking breaks or holidays are announced in advance, and billing is adjusted accordingly.

    Can I change my billing date?
    No. Billing dates are tied to your subscription start date and cannot be manually changed. If you need a different billing rhythm, you may cancel and re-subscribe on a date that better fits your needs.

  • Where do I pick up my subscription bread?
    Subscription pickup locations and times are consistent each week and listed on the subscriptions page and in your confirmation emails.

    Can someone else pick up my bread for me?
    Yes. You’re welcome to send a friend or family member to pick up your order.

    Can I change my pickup location or delivery preference?
    Changes can be made with advance notice before the weekly cutoff, subject to availability.

    Do subscriptions qualify for local delivery?
    Yes, subscriptions are eligible for local delivery within the designated radius. Delivery details and fees are listed separately.

  • Can I pause or skip a week?
    Yes. You may pause or skip a delivery with advance notice before the weekly cutoff time. Cutoff time is Monday evening each week.

    How do I pause or cancel my subscription?
    Subscriptions can be managed through your customer account dashboard. If you need assistance, you may also contact us directly. Text 404-316-8071. We will respond as soon as possible.

    Is there a cancellation fee?
    No. There are no cancellation fees, but cancellations must occur before the next billing cycle to avoid being charged.
